I've killed several gobblers over them. Only used the gobbler decoy. Very realistic looking head on and a turkey can't figure out the deal when they get up to them. A gobbler almost always attack from behind and when they walk around behind this one and it's still looking at them it hangs them up. Almost funny the way that they will keep circling them. You can tell that they are trying to get behind them.
